LINUX.ORG.RU

Звук в VirtualBox

 , ,


1

2

Host: Gentoo Linux AMD 64. Guest: Windows XP.

Звук работает, но похрипывает, как будто железо не справляется с эмуляцией. Хотя компьютер достаточно мощный. В настройках VirtualBox выставлено ALSA, AC97, пробовал играться с этими параметрами - на результат не влияло (либо звук вовсе пропадал)

Есть необходимость запускать ПО для видеоконференций, которое хоть и имеет свою версию под Linux, но эта версия не поддерживает видео и звук. Да и к тому же без бубна не работает, надо кучу *.so файлов подменять/добавлять. (вообще слабо понятно, что она поддерживает, и чем отличается от браузерной). Называется fuze meeting, если играет роль какую-то - https://www.fuzebox.com/download

Под wine тоже не запускается.

Хочу попробовать под VirtualBox, но похрипывающий звук - не дело. Пробовал играться с дровами на AC97 - погоды тоже не сделало.

Нашёл темку - Проблемы со звуком в virtualbox - результат там такой же, так ничего и не решили.

Может, стоит попробовать другие виртуалки? vmware? qemu? Или отказаться от этой идеи, ничего не выйдет? Или можно поколдовать с wine?

dual boot выглядит как единственное решение, но это неудобно.

Ответ на: комментарий от fornlr

Нет у меня usb-звуковой карты. :( Правда, есть микрофон в веб-камере... но динамика там нет. Покупать придётся.

Это правда единственный вариант?

Кстати, с usb-звуковухой (и заодно usb-веб-камерой) вообще проблем быть не должно ведь?

BattleCoder ★★★★★
() автор топика
Ответ на: комментарий от BattleCoder

да, единственные потенциальные проблемы - с скоростями (виртуалка должна 2.0 поддерживать)

lazyklimm ★★★★★
()

kvm + spice можно бы протестить

invokercd ★★★★
()

Единственно на мой взгляд решение - проброс. Я бы ещё поигрался jack. Можно к примеру по сети через jack их связать. Либо как вариант просто попробовать этот софт под wine.

xSudo ★★★
()
Ответ на: комментарий от xSudo

А можно поподробнее?.. А то ничего непонятно? Может, пару ссылочек?

Под wine не запускается. Что-то мне подсказывает, что и пытаться не стоит. Ща кину лог ошибок, но вряд ли это что-то даст.

Эта программа и под венду работает жутко криво, неудивительно, что с wine проблемы.

BattleCoder ★★★★★
() автор топика
Ответ на: комментарий от xSudo

Можете попробовать сами, ради интереса. Вообще серверная версия (чтобы конференции созывать) - платная, и у меня её нет, но клиентская бесплатная, и было бы неплохо для начала просто запустить ^^

https://www.fuzebox.com/download

Устанавливается без проблем особых (запускать msiexec /i installer.msi )

Потом вижу в консоли:

libpng warning: Application built with libpng-1.6.8 but running with 1.5.15
...(куча таких же строчек)...
err:msvcrt:MSVCRT__invalid_parameter (null):0 (null): (null) 0
fixme:dbghelp:elf_search_auxv can't find symbol in module
err:seh:raise_exception Unhandled exception code c0000005 flags 0 addr 0x7bcbf005

Предупреждение про libpng вряд ли на что-то влияет особо. В любом случае у меня ligpng-1.5.15 даже не установлен, только 1.6.8

BattleCoder ★★★★★
() автор топика
Последнее исправление: BattleCoder (всего исправлений: 1)
Ответ на: комментарий от BattleCoder

Если завалялась звуковушка pci, можно попробовать её пробросить. https://www.virtualbox.org/manual/ch09.html#pcipassthrough

С jack думаю будет больше танцев с бубном и ещё не факт, что всё пойдёт нормально. http://netjack.sourceforge.net/

Ссылок с Русским описание почему то толком найти не могу сразу.

xSudo ★★★
()

usb-веб-камерой

С камерой проблем не должно быть. У меня и звук и видео по USB, имею в виду камеру. По USB звуковухе могу завтра попробовать. У меня есть USB Creative..., рублей за 800. Сегодня ,к сожалению, не могу звук включать. Маленьких уложил.

nihil ★★★★★
()
Ответ на: комментарий от nihil

Да не к спеху ни в коем случае, но если попробуете, будет здорово. Заодно проверьте встроенную звуковуху. Действительно ли она у всех в virtualbox так плохо работает, а то вдруг у меня одного, и я просто что-то не то делаю?..

BattleCoder ★★★★★
() автор топика
Ответ на: комментарий от xSudo

Именно PCI нет. Но есть же размазанная на материнке. С ней не прокатит?..

lspci же пишет:

...
01:00.1 Audio device: NVIDIA Corporation GF116 High Definition Audio Controller (rev a1)
...
BattleCoder ★★★★★
() автор топика
Последнее исправление: BattleCoder (всего исправлений: 1)
Ответ на: комментарий от BattleCoder

Заодно проверьте встроенную звуковуху.

В боксе Wxp стоит и проблем нет. Ни хрипов ни чего ещё. Настройки звука даже не трогал ( ALSA AC97).VirtualBox 4.2.18.

А каков комп - железо?

nihil ★★★★★
()
Ответ на: комментарий от nihil

Ну процессор AMD Phenom(tm) II X4 B50 Processor, 4 ядра, виртуалке отдаю одно. Оно как бы и не особо нагружается вроде бы. Аппаратная виртуализация есть и включена.

Оперативки до хрена и больше (8 гигов), сначала отдавал 512 виртуалке, попробовал увеличить до 1024 - думаю, не в ней дело, winxp не такая уж прожорливая.

Звук тестил в skype (test call делал). Возможно, что skype тормоз. Кстати, ради интереса попробую просто видео запустить играться... какое-нибудь.

Звуковуху свою выше писал уже.

BattleCoder ★★★★★
() автор топика

Комп совсем не мощный, хрипов нет, 13.10, XP в VirtualBox. Микрофон пропал куда-то, это да.

ilovewindows ★★★★★
()
Ответ на: комментарий от ilovewindows

Да. Наверное. Попробую через audacity записать и посмотрю, что выйдет.

BattleCoder ★★★★★
() автор топика
Ответ на: комментарий от BattleCoder

да, alsa в системе
в asound.conf (или где ты её конфигуряешь?) задать

rate 44100
i.e., только это с dmix и system-wide эквалайзером

megabaks ★★★★
()
Последнее исправление: megabaks (всего исправлений: 1)
Ответ на: комментарий от megabaks

Ага, понял, ~/.asoundrc. Покопаюсь. Но на хост-системе же проблем со звуком никогда не было. И странно, если по умолчанию не 44100?.. 22050 что ли?..

Ладно, это всё риторические вопросы, в документации покопаюсь.

BattleCoder ★★★★★
() автор топика
Ответ на: комментарий от BattleCoder

вообще-то давно по у молчанию 48000
отсюда геморы со звуком в гамах и прочих поделках.

megabaks ★★★★
()

Если будешь пробрасывать USB, учти что в коробке это сделано криво.

Попробуй семерочку, там используется другой драйвер для виртуальной звуковой карты.

Ваще такие вещи у вмтвари сделаны намного лучше.

Lordwind ★★★★★
()
Ответ на: комментарий от Lordwind

Пока я был в криокамере (вмтварью последний раз пользовался лет 5 назад) - workstation также платная (можно триалку использовать), а player бесплатная?

BattleCoder ★★★★★
() автор топика
Ответ на: комментарий от BattleCoder

да, просто плеер стал вполне приличным по функционалу

Lordwind ★★★★★
()

Сегодня потестил USB CREATIVE SB. Звук в виртуальной Wxp нормальный, без примесей. Скайп тормозит: видео в нём - слайд-шоу, звук запаздывает, но опять таки чистый. Железо для виртуалки: одно ядро от core2duo и 1024 памяти.

Вот сама звуковушка:http://www.ulmart.ru/goods/197829

Вообщем работает как и встроенная без проблем. Не факт, что тебе поможет юсбишная звуковуха.

nihil ★★★★★
()
Ответ на: комментарий от anonymous

Нашёлся таки один, я уж думал, никто не спросит.

Нет и не было у меня никакой пульзаудии.

BattleCoder ★★★★★
() автор топика
Ответ на: комментарий от nihil

Ага, я понял. попробовал audacity - замечательный звук. skype тупит. Кстати, вполне возможно, будет тупить и эта проприетарщина для видеоконференций. Ну есть только один способ проверить.

В общем, вопрос решён.

BattleCoder ★★★★★
() автор топика
28 ноября 2014 г.
Ответ на: комментарий от anonymous

Ничего не решил с тех пор. Зато стало неактуально больше, fuze meeting таки заработал под gnu/linux (нативная версия) со звуком и видео.

Жаль, кривая жутко. Особенно интерфейс неудобный. Но лучше, чем ничего.

BattleCoder ★★★★★
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.